I have owned a 318iSE since buying it new in September 1999 which has covered just over 98,000 trouble-free miles, until recently that is.

The problem which is causing concern is that following a broken hose in late November 2004 the vehicle was recovered to my local BMW garage where the problem was rectified but needed, including other, the following work:

‘Remove and install intake manifold top section’ and

‘Replace engine block cooling pipe’.

On collecting the car the engine was sluggish, which I put down to it being recovered and being laid-up for a week whilst we were on holiday. Later that day the engine warning light came on again and I returned for a diagnostic check which revealed that mixture levels were slightly out. The light was reset and off I went, after mentioning that the performance was intermittently sluggish.

A couple of days later, still with sluggish performance, the light came on again; following which the performance returned to normal with over 44 mpg being returned on runs of around 100 miles of motorway driving.

I have just returned from the garage which has been unable to extinguish the light after 2 hours on their diagnostic machine, which showed that there were no problems and have to arrange a further session.

Mention was made that it could be a problem with an injector, but with everything appearing to be normal, apart from the engine warning light being permanently on, I feel reluctant to authorise any work.

Has anyone out there experienced similar problems?
